Summary
This study is testing a new version of a common eye imaging machine, called Optical Coherence Tomography (OCT), on healthy volunteers. The goal is to check the image quality and test new software to make the scanner faster and clearer. Researchers hope this improved technology will one day help doctors better detect eye diseases.
